Investigation of the effects of specific chemotherapeutics and cholesterol drugs on an in vitro brain tumor model

Özet (EN)
Althouhg brain tumors are less common in adults compared to other tumors, they are one of the most common causes of cancer-related morbidity and mortality in the infants and children. One of the biggest problems about brain tumors is that chemotherapy drugs cannot reach the brain in the desired dose due to the blood-brain barrier. Chemotherapy drugs are given in combination with other drugs to increase treatment efficiency. On the other hand; Cholesterol is a steroid substance that forms an important component of the animal cell membrane. The loss of cholesterol feedback inhibition mechanisms that regulate cholesterol synthesis is an important feature of malignant transformation. From the literature review, a reasonable assumption is that tumor growth inhibition can be achieved by restricting the presence of cholesterol or cholesterol synthesis. Recently, it was found that simvastatin and lovastatin, which are cholesterol-regulating drugs, and the effects of simultaneous administration of chemotherapeutics (gemcitabine and carmustine) on in vitro brain tumor model were not investigated. In the current thesis, ıt ıs aimed to fill this gap in the literature. Cell Viability Detection Kit-8 was used to determine the effects of test compounds on cell viability and IC20 concentrations were determined for each compound in human neuroblastoma SH-SY5Y cells. Then, the effects of test compounds on apoptosis were revealed both colorimetrically and by western blot analysis. According to the results obtained, statins inhibited proliferation in a dose-dependent manner, both when administered alone and with chemotherapeutics. In particular, it was demonstrated in both methods that lovastatin induced apoptosis by increasing the efficiency of both gemcitabine and carmustine. As a result of the findings from the tests, ıt is suggested that statins may be a new neuroblastoma treatment option that could potentially enhance the effectiveness of currently used anticancer drugs.
